AdManagerAdRequest

public final class AdManagerAdRequest extends AdRequest


AdManagerAdRequest, Google Ad Manager'dan reklam almak için kullanılan hedefleme bilgilerini içerir. Reklam istekleri AdManagerAdRequest.Builder kullanılarak oluşturulur.

Özet

İç içe yerleştirilmiş türler

Bir AdManagerAdRequest oluşturur.

Herkese açık yöntemler

Bundle

Özel hedefleme parametrelerini döndürür.

String

Sıklık sınırı, kitle segmentasyonu ve hedefleme, sıralı reklam rotasyonu ve cihazlar arasında diğer kitleye dayalı reklam yayınlama kontrolleri için kullanılan tanımlayıcıyı döndürür.

Devralınan Sabitler

com.google.android.gms.ads.AdRequest kaynağından
static final String
DEVICE_ID_EMULATOR = "B3EEABB8EE11C2BE770B684D95219ECB"

setTestDeviceIds ile kullanılacak emülatörler için deviceId.

static final int

Uygulama kimliği eksik olduğu için reklam isteği gönderilmedi.

static final int

Dahili bir durum oluşmuştur. Örneğin, reklam sunucusundan geçersiz bir yanıt alınmıştır.

static final int

Reklam dizesi geçersiz.

static final int

Reklam isteği geçersizdi (ör. reklam birimi kimliği yanlıştı).

static final int

Uyumlulaştırma bağdaştırıcısı reklam isteğini doldurmamıştır.

static final int

Reklam isteği, ağ bağlantısı nedeniyle başarısız oldu.

static final int

Reklam isteği başarılı oldu ancak reklam envanteri olmadığı için reklam döndürülmedi.

static final int

Reklam dizesindeki istek kimliği bulunamadı.

static final int

Maksimum içerik URL'si uzunluğu.

Devralınan yöntemler

com.google.android.gms.ads.AdRequest kaynağından
@Nullable String

Reklam dizesini alır.

String

İçerik URL'si hedefleme bilgilerini döndürür.

@Nullable Bundle
<T extends CustomEvent> getCustomEventExtrasBundle(Class<T> adapterClass)

Bu yöntem kullanımdan kaldırılmıştır.

Bunun yerine getNetworkExtrasBundle kullanın.

Set<String>

Hedefleme bilgileri anahtar kelimelerini döndürür.

List<String>

Komşu içerik URL'lerinin listesini veya URL ayarlanmamışsa boş bir liste döndürür.

@Nullable Bundle
<T extends MediationExtrasReceiver> getNetworkExtrasBundle(
    Class<T> adapterClass
)

Belirli bir reklam ağı bağdaştırıcısı için aktarılacak ek parametreleri döndürür.

String

Reklam isteğinin kaynağını tanımlamak için istek aracısı dizesini döndürür.

boolean

Bu cihaz test reklamları alacaksa true değerini döndürür.

Herkese açık yöntemler

getCustomTargeting

public Bundle getCustomTargeting()

Özel hedefleme parametrelerini döndürür.

getPublisherProvidedId

public String getPublisherProvidedId()

Sıklık sınırı, kitle segmentasyonu ve hedefleme, sıralı reklam rotasyonu ve cihazlar arasında diğer kitleye dayalı reklam yayınlama kontrolleri için kullanılan tanımlayıcıyı döndürür.